Question 1: Which AHA monitoring category applies to patients who are in the first 48 hours after acute MI?
- Class I (monitoring indicated) (Correct answer)
- Class II (monitoring of uncertain benefit)
- Class III (monitoring not indicated)
- Class IV (monitoring contraindicated)
Correct answer: Class I (monitoring indicated)
The AHA designates continuous cardiac monitoring as Class I (clearly indicated) during the first 48 hours after acute MI.

Question 3: A patient's ECG shows a sudden straight line. What is the FIRST action the nurse should take?
- Check the patient and verify lead connections before assuming asystole (Correct answer)
- Begin CPR immediately
- Call a code blue
- Administer epinephrine
Correct answer: Check the patient and verify lead connections before assuming asystole
A flat line on a monitor most often reflects a loose lead or electrode, not asystole; always assess the patient first.
Question 4: What does 'signal-averaged ECG' (SAECG) primarily detect?
- Late potentials indicating risk for ventricular arrhythmias (Correct answer)
- P-wave morphology changes
- QT interval prolongation
- ST-segment elevation patterns
Correct answer: Late potentials indicating risk for ventricular arrhythmias
SAECG detects ventricular late potentials, which indicate areas of slow conduction predisposing to re-entrant ventricular arrhythmias.

Question 6: What is the purpose of the QTc (corrected QT) interval calculation in monitoring?
- To adjust QT for heart rate and identify prolongation risk for torsades de pointes (Correct answer)
- To measure P-wave duration accurately
- To detect ST changes independent of rate
- To calculate left ventricular ejection fraction
Correct answer: To adjust QT for heart rate and identify prolongation risk for torsades de pointes
QTc corrects the QT interval for heart rate, allowing standardized assessment of prolongation risk for fatal arrhythmias.
